My PC has a blue screen. When I reboot Windows it does not work. What do I do?
Take a note of the details on the 'blue screen'. This will often give a code just after the word 'STOP'....... Make a note of these details - they will help us find and resolve the problem.(Were specifically interested in the following 10 characters - usually in the format of 0X0000007B)
